A Grittier, More Realistic Star Wars Narrative
Andor boldly departs from the typical Star Wars formula, trading lighthearted adventures for a grittier, more realistic narrative. This "dark Star Wars" approach sets it apart, focusing on grounded characters and complex political machinations. The Andor tone is strikingly different, embracing realism and darker themes not often explored within the franchise.
-
Examples of gritty realism: Early reviews highlight intense interrogation scenes, morally ambiguous choices by characters, and the stark realities of rebellion against a powerful empire. The show doesn't shy away from violence and its consequences. The cinematography emphasizes the bleakness and harshness of the environments.
-
Comparison to other Star Wars series: Unlike the more optimistic tones of shows like The Mandalorian, Andor embraces a darker, more mature aesthetic, similar in style to some elements of Rogue One. The character development feels more nuanced and grounded, building tension slowly and deliberately.
-
Character development and plot structure: The series favors slow-burn storytelling, focusing on character arcs and detailed world-building. Each episode contributes to a larger narrative arc, creating a compelling and immersive viewing experience.
Cassian Andor's Compelling Character Arc
Diego Luna’s portrayal of Cassian Andor is captivating. The Andor character development is central to the show, showcasing his evolution from a morally ambiguous figure to a committed Rebel. This Cassian Andor character study is a key aspect of the show's appeal.
-
His motivations and transformation: We see Cassian’s journey from a lone wolf driven by personal vendettas to a leader fighting for a larger cause. His motivations shift and evolve as he experiences the consequences of his actions.
-
Relationships with other characters: Andor explores the complex relationships Cassian forms, both with fellow rebels and with those in positions of authority within the Empire. These relationships drive the plot and shape his decisions.
-
Moral ambiguity and complexity: Cassian isn't a straightforward hero; he operates in the gray areas of morality. This moral ambiguity adds depth and complexity to his character, making him far more relatable and compelling.
Expanding the Star Wars Universe's Political Landscape
Andor significantly deepens the political landscape of the Star Wars universe. It delves into the intricacies of the Rebellion and the Galactic Empire, offering a fascinating look at the struggles and conflicts shaping the galaxy. The Andor politics are intricate and compelling, setting the stage for the events of Rogue One.
-
Nuances of the rebellion: The series demonstrates the internal conflicts and struggles within the Rebel Alliance. It's not a unified force, but a collection of diverse groups with differing agendas and motivations.
-
Strategic implications: The show highlights the strategic planning and execution required to take on the vast resources of the Galactic Empire. Every action has significant repercussions, emphasizing the high stakes of the rebellion.
-
Adding depth to Star Wars history: Andor significantly expands upon the backstory of the Rebellion, filling in crucial gaps and adding layers of complexity to the Star Wars timeline. This Star Wars political intrigue enhances the broader lore significantly.
